Health Benefits

High in protein, sturgeon meat supports muscle growth and repair, making it an excellent choice for athletes and active individuals.
Rich in omega-3 fatty acids, it promotes heart health by reducing inflammation and lowering cholesterol levels.
Contains essential vitamins and minerals, including Vitamin B12 and selenium, which are vital for energy metabolism and immune function.
Low in carbohydrates, making it suitable for low-carb and ketogenic diets.

Possible Risks & Side Effects

!Raw sturgeon meat may carry a risk of foodborne illness if not sourced from reputable suppliers.
!Individuals with seafood allergies should avoid sturgeon meat as it may trigger allergic reactions.

How to Prepare & Consume

Best enjoyed raw as sashimi or lightly seared to preserve its delicate flavor. Ensure it is sourced from a trusted supplier to minimize health risks.

Smart Selection & Storage

How to Select

Choose sturgeon meat that is firm, moist, and has a fresh ocean smell. Avoid any that appears discolored or has an off odor.

How to Store

Store in the coldest part of the refrigerator, ideally in a sealed container, and consume within 1-2 days.

Healthy Recipes

Sturgeon Tartare with Avocado and Lime

A fresh and zesty tartare that combines the rich flavors of raw sturgeon meat with creamy avocado and a hint of lime, perfect for a light appetizer.

Ingredients
  • 200g raw sturgeon meat, finely diced
  • 1 ripe avocado, diced
  • 1 lime, juiced
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on fresh cilantro, chopped
  •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
  1. 1. In a bowl, combine the diced sturgeon meat, avocado, lime juice, olive oil, and cilantro.
  2. 2. Season with salt and pepper, mixing gently to avoid mashing the avocado.
  3. 3. Serve immediately on a chilled plate, garnished with additional cilantro.

Sturgeon Ceviche with Mango and Chili

A vibrant ceviche that features raw sturgeon marinated in citrus juices, complemented by sweet mango and a kick of chili for a refreshing dish.

Ingredients
  • 200g raw sturgeon meat, thinly sliced
  • 1 mango, diced
  • Juice of 2 limes
  • 1 small red chili, finely chopped
  • 1/4 cup red onion, finely diced
  • Salt to taste
Instructions
  1. 1. In a bowl, combine the sturgeon slices with lime juice and let marinate for 15 minutes.
  2. 2. Add the diced mango, chili, red onion, and salt, mixing gently.
  3. 3. Serve chilled, garnished with lime wedges.
